asm/rwonce: Remove smp_read_barrier_depends() invocation

Alpha overrides __READ_ONCE() directly, so there's no need to use
smp_read_barrier_depends() in the core code. This also means that
__READ_ONCE() can be relied upon to provide dependency ordering.
